What to expect
This is a typical itinerary for this product
Stop At: Mirador de la Concepcion, Isla de LA PALMA, provincia de Santa Cruz de Tenerife., 38710, Brena Alta, Tenerife Spain
Mirador de la Concepción. Located in the highest part of the volcano, the Caldereta "declared natural space" where you can see both the crater and the capital of the island.
Duration: 15 minutes
Stop At: 38758 Tacande de Arriba, Santa Cruz de Tenerife, Spain
The next stop will be in the Tacande Neighborhood Exclusion Zone, where you will have the opportunity to see the Tajogaite Volcano up close and touch the lava with your hand.
Duration: 20 minutes
Stop At: Playa Tazacorte, Av. el Emigrante, 38779 Tazacorte, La Palma Spain
Once in Tazacorte we will be able to taste a typical menu near the beach.
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: El Paso, El Paso, La Palma, Canary Islands
We will have the opportunity to walk in the neighborhood of La Laguna to see the remains of the houses destroyed by the lava. the images will be amazing.
Duration: 20 minutes
Stop At: Tajuya, Tajuya, Tenerife, Canary Islands
We will stop at the Tajuya viewpoint to observe the Cumbre Vieja volcano, born on 19 September 2021, which destroyed more than 1, 000 homes during its eruption. This place has been used by the press around the world to record the last eruption of the Canary Islands.
